    Treatment of class II furcation defects with autogenous bone graft associated with Bichat’s fat pad: case report

    The periodontal treatment of teeth with furcation defect is clinically challenging. In cases of class II furcation defects, the regenerative surgery shows low morbidity and good prognosis when correctly indicated. The aim of the presentstudy is to report a treatment option for class II furcation defect through autogenous bone graft associated with the Bichat’s fat pad. Case report: A 59-year-old female patient was diagnosed with class II furcation defect in the left mandibular first molar. The treatment comprised surgical reconstruction of the defect with a combination of maxillary tuberosity bone graft and Bichat’s fat pad. The clinical and radiographic follow-up of 180 days showed bone formation inthe furcation area and absence of probing depth. Conclusion: An association of autogenous graft form the maxillary tuberosity with a Bichat’s fat pad proved to be a safe, low cost, and effective therapy for the regenerative treatment of class II furcation.The periodontal treatment of teeth with furcation defect is clinically challenging.     Effect of the use of different periodontal curettes on the topography and roughness of root surface

    Periodontal scaling is the treatment approach most used to remove dental calculus, plaque, and altered cementum from root surface. During root decontamination, the instruments used leave the root rougher and more irregular. Objective: To verify the root surface after mechanical scaling with different Gracey curettes steel through SEM and superficial roughness analyses. Material and methods: Twelve teeth were embedded in acrylic resin. The teeth were instrumented with new Gracey curettes Gracey 5/6 from different brands. The groups (n=2) were divided into: control, no instrumentation (GC); carbon steel (CSN); stainless steel Neumar (SSN); stainless steel Millenium (SSM); premium steel Neumar (PSN); Hu-Friedy (HF). An area measuring 3 x 3 mm2was marked on the distal surface of the root to guide the Reading of the root topography on SEM and rugosimeter. The data were analyzed by a single examiner previously calibrated. SEM analysis was based on scores of the root surface smoothness after scaling. We analyzed the parameters of mean roughness (Ra) and mean roughness deepness (Rz). SEM data were submitted to statistical analysis through Fisher’s exact test (p < 0.002) and roughness data by Anova followed by Student t test. Results: The quality of the active surface of the curette demonstrated by SEM and roughness analyses that it can exert difference in the result regarding to the homogeneity produced after the scaling of root surface. Group SSM demonstrated a homogenous root surface (score 0) in SEM and better smoothness in rugosimeter analysis. Conclusion: According to com the methodology used, the group of curettes that provided better smoothness of root surface after scaling was SSM

    Tratamento de pigmentações melânicas com instrumentos rotatórios e lâmina de bisturi Treatment of melanic pigmentations with rotary instruments and scalpel blade

    Introduction: Oral pigmentary lesions may have different clinical characteristics, ranging from physiological pigmentation, such as melanin spots, to something more serious, such as malignant melanoma. Due to the great variety of pigmented lesions, the treatments are varied and individualized. Objective: This clinical case reports a case of melanocytic removal through a surgical technique that associates rotary instruments and scalpel blade. Case report: A 45-year-old patient, melanoderma, sought care at the Positivo University, complaining about the dark spots visible on his gum, and the discomfort they caused him when smiling. After the clinical examination, the presence of melanocytic pigmentation was diagnosed and the proposed treatment was surgical removal of spots with a drill and scalpel blade. In the immediate postoperative period, the patient presented good healing and reported only mild burning in the first three days. After 60 days, the gingiva was healed, with no relapsing spots.     Treatment of gummy smile: Gingival recontouring with the containment of the elevator muscle of the upper lip and wing of nose. A surgery innovation technique

    The containment of the elevator muscle of the upper lip and wing of nose was used for the treatment of patients with gummy smile. This technique had corrected esthetic alterations of smile, reducing the upper lip elevation, which results in a smaller gingival display. An upper lip lengthening as well as a reduction in the upper lip shortening when the patient smiled could be observed. The high smile line was corrected without compromising the labial harmony. This study presents an innovative and effective therapeutic option to obtain a natural and harmonious smile. The patient expressed a high degree of satisfaction

    The use of the digital smile design concept as an auxiliary tool in periodontal plastic surgery

    Periodontal surgery associated with prior waxing, mock-up, and the use of digital tools to design the smile is the current trend of reverse planning in periodontal plastic surgery. The objective of this study is to report a surgical resolution of the gummy smile using a prior esthetic design with the use of digital tools. A digital smile design and mock-up were used for performing gingival recontouring surgery. The relationship between the facial and dental measures and the incisal plane with the horizontal facial plane of reference were evaluated. The relative dental height x width was measured, and the dental contour drawing was inserted. Complementary lines are drawn such as the gingival zenith, joining lines of the gingival and incisal battlements. The periodontal esthetic was improved according to the established design digital smile pattern. These results demonstrate the importance of surgical techniques and are well accepted by patients and are easy to perform for the professional. When properly planned, they provide the desired expectations. Periodontal Surgical procedures associated with the design digital smile facilitate the communication between the patient and the professional. It is, therefore, essential to demonstrate the reverse planning of the smile and periodontal parameters with approval by the patient to solve the esthetic problem
